DoubleClick ignoring Google Adwords TOS

Now that DoubleClick is a google owned company does it mean they no longer have to comply with the Google Adwords TOS (terms of service)?

I had some adwords ads showing on one of my sites this morning which I didn’t like, so checked the display URL and added it to my competitive filter. A few hours later the ads were still showing so I decided to investigate further. I right clicked the ad, copied the source and pasted it in to Notepad to discover that the ad URL was completely different to the displayed URL, and was in fact going via clickserve.uk.dartsearch.net part of the DoubleClick network.

Now according to the Adwords TOS, the display url must be the same as the ad URL which enables us to know who to add to our competitive filters. If Doubleclick are allowed to do what they are doing it means we can know longer block individual ads without having to put dartsearch.net in our competitive filters, which could in turn block legitimate ads.

If DoubleClick are allowed to get away with things like this it akes a complete mockery of the AdSense competitive ad filter.

Create a seed keyword list

Red Evolution have devised a fantastic new keyword tool which lets you create your own scenario for a search query. After creating the scenario, a unique URL is created which you can then email to friends, post on forums,  send to people to test for you, etc. These people then enter the search phrase they would use for each scenario and the system generates a seed keywords list.
